Job description

Job Title:Financial Reporting Analyst

Department:Finance

Location:Swords, Dublin (Main Street) (Free parking available)

Reports To:Financial Controller

Work Model:Hybrid – 3 days in office, 2 days remote

Contract Type:20-month fixed-term contract with a view to permanency

Basic Purpose

We are hiring on behalf of a leading global company in thelogistics and supply chain industry. TheFinancial Reporting Analystwill play a key role in delivering high-quality, cost-effective managerial reporting in line with accounting principles and corporate policies. This position supports strategic decision-making through accurate financial analysis and reporting.

Principal Accountabilities

  • Timely and accurate processing of the monthly financial close
  • Preparation of month-end accruals
  • Maintain first-class financial reporting aligned with group policies
  • Monitor and analyze results at terminal and product level vs. budget and prior year
  • Support management in optimizing decisions through financial performance insights
  • Coordinate balance sheet reviews
  • Ensure compliance with accounting standards and internal policies
  • Facilitate internal and external audits
  • Report monthly on internal controls to the region
  • Build str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ders
  • Manage multiple stakeholders, including Shared Service Centres and external auditors
  • Assist with AP queries and systems (Concur & Coupa)
  • Prepare Power BI reports
  • Contribute to financial projects and ad hoc analysis
